After Sandor sent me the problem that became #5 on the second round of the USAMTS, I came up with the following based on it:

Given acute triangle ABC in plane $\mathcal{P}$, a point Q in space is defined such that <AQB = <BQC = 90 degrees and <AQC = 120 degrees. Given triangle ABC, construct with ruler and compass the projection of point Q onto plane $\mathcal{P}$. (All constructions are to be done in plane $\mathcal{P}$.)

We considered this for a while for the USAMTS, then decided it might be a touch too evil, at least for round 2.
